WebApr 13, 2024 · First thing’s first, the TITLE of your screenplay! The actual title should be written in ALL capital letters. This can also be bold or underlined, but no matter what, it must ALWAYS be capitalized style. The title should be centered horizontally on the page. So take the time to make sure your screenplay is in the correct format! Read More: How to Format a Script Tags gory ritualWebJan 31, 2024 · Putting In Screenplay Terms and Notations. 1. Put “FADE IN” on the first page. The first page of your screenplay should always include a “FADE IN” note at the top of the page as the first item on the page.
